当前位置: 首页 > 知识库问答 >
问题:

谷歌路线API(中转模式)每个请求只返回一条可选路线

钱钊
2023-03-14

我已经建立了一个小应用程序,在运输模式下调用Google Directions API。它是有效的——尽管如此,它只返回一条可能的路线,因此没有其他选择。通常我希望有3-4种选择。

例如:http://maps.googleapis.com/maps/api/directions/json?origin=bieberstrasse,杜塞尔多夫

返回的JSON结构具有预期的“routes”数组,但该数组始终只有一个元素。我曾在巴西和德国的地址尝试过这种方法——国家不重要,我只有一条路线。

我错过了什么参数吗?有人能帮我吗?

共有1个答案

束俊材
2023-03-14

如果需要备选路线,请指定请求参数alternatives=true

http://maps.googleapis.com/maps/api/directions/json?alternatives=true

 类似资料:
  • DrawPath()用于在地图上绘制多边形。 现在我的问题是路线没有正确显示在地图上,因为它在链接中有航路点。我在Android4.2上使用它 我的链接是http://maps.googleapis.com/maps/api/directions/json?origin=18.XXX,73.XXXdestination=18。三十、 73。XXX

  • 最近我开始使用camel,我发现它有可能满足我的许多集成层需求。 我创建了一个java客户机应用程序(不在任何容器中运行),其中定义了两个路由: 路由1:将文件从传入文件夹1移动到文件夹2 route2:将文件内容从folderx移动到mq队列。 我启动我的应用程序,这些路由正在轮询这些文件夹并相应地路由消息。 谁能给我解释一下路线是如何工作的?骆驼(上下文)是否为每个路由创建线程。到底会发生什么

  • 我试图使用c#和谷歌表格api在电子表格中追加一行单元格。我拿到密码了 问题是我得到的唯一一个sheetID来自url,是一个String。在哪里可以找到作为整数的工作表ID以及如何执行AppendCellsRequest? 希望你能帮忙。

  • 我试图在两个位置之间找到驾驶方向: 我尝试过的代码: 但是这在两点之间画了一条直线。 有没有其他方法/途径可以得到这两点之间的行驶方向。

  • 我是一个新的反应和反应。我已经花了几个小时了,我只是走到了死胡同。 我正在使用CreateReact应用程序和用于css的bulma。我的依赖项: }, 我查看了stackoverflow的所有相关问题,创建了react应用程序文档,并在他们的回购协议中搜索了他们的开放问题部分,谷歌搜索了所有可能的关键字。我不知所措。 我的路由器只会呈现一个路由(Homeroute)。 如何让它显示/创建路线?

  • 我想从谷歌云视觉应用编程接口中获取数据,并看到输入可以以Base64和图像uri格式给出。但是Base64似乎太长了,以uri上传图像需要一些额外的时间。请让我知道,如果有人知道这方面的任何其他工作。